Splet16. apr. 2016 · A real-world example of livelock occurs when two people meet in a narrow corridor, and each tries to be polite by moving aside to let the other pass, but they end up swaying from side to side without making any progress because they both repeatedly move the same way at the same time. Splet20. dec. 2024 · Then, once the swaying starts, each person tries to stay upright, with these adjustments destabilizing the bridge even further. ... The transfer of energy to the bridge from the footsteps, and the subsequent rocking of the bridge, is an example of negative damping – very small vibrations causing much larger end results. Any opinions in the examples do not represent the opinion of the Cambridge … charms for crocs nzSplet11. nov. 2024 · A recent example is the Squibb Park Bridge in Brooklyn ... but also side to side. The increased bouncing and swaying were a safety concern for pedestrians walking 50 feet over the park. The Brooklyn Bridge Park Corporation sought $3 million in a lawsuit against HNTB Corporation, the bridge’s original designers.
